
Huntington Beach to Keep Fighting Despite State’s Recent Court Victory on Affordable Housing
During a May 20 gathering at the Huntington Beach Elks Club, City Attorney Michael Gates updated residents on a slew of lawsuits the city is facing, including one that could force city officials to adopt a state-mandated plan for affordable housing. Last week California Attorney General Rob Bonta announced he and Gov. Gavin Newsom had secured a lower court victory in a March 2023 state lawsuit over the city’s failure to plan for housing. But the recent success will be short lived as the city pushes forward in a battle for local control, Mr. Gates said in his update. “I said this before, and I’ll say it again, this battle over housing for Huntington Beach is a long battle. Nothing is going to happen overnight. … There’s a lot more to this, including an appeal we will file,” he said in front of a crowd of a few dozen residents....
